Lion's Mane for Nerve Health
Animal evidence for peripheral nerve regeneration with lions mane is genuinely interesting, but human nerve outcomes have not been tested.

The preclinical case is the strongest part of the lion's mane story: in rodent models of peripheral nerve crush injury, lion's mane extract accelerates axonal regeneration and functional recovery, and hericenones and erinacines stimulate NGF synthesis in cell culture - NGF being genuinely important for sensory and sympathetic neuron maintenance. What is missing is human data. There are no adequate randomised trials of lion's mane for peripheral neuropathy, nerve injury recovery or any nerve-specific human endpoint. Extrapolating rat sciatic nerve recovery to human neuropathy is a substantial leap, and NGF itself has failed in human neuropathy trials partly because of pain side effects.

Peripheral neuropathy needs a diagnosis, not a supplement: diabetes, B12 deficiency, alcohol, hypothyroidism, chemotherapy, HIV and autoimmune causes are all identifiable and several are reversible if caught early - B12 deficiency in particular causes irreversible damage if left untreated. Numbness with weakness, bladder or bowel change, or rapid progression needs urgent assessment. Blood glucose control is the single most important intervention in diabetic neuropathy. Safety: lion's mane is generally well tolerated at 1-3 g/day over months, with mild gastrointestinal upset most common; skin rash and rare respiratory allergic reactions have been reported, and it should be avoided with mushroom allergy. Possible mild antiplatelet and glucose-lowering activity means caution with anticoagulants, antiplatelets and diabetes medication - the latter matters here, since many people with neuropathy are diabetic - and stopping two weeks before surgery. No established upper intake level, and no long-term safety data beyond about a year. No safety data in pregnancy or breastfeeding - avoid in both, and in children.
